Greenberg, Ben Norton was born on May 30, 1903 in Omaha. Son of Samuel and Rose (Coren) Greenberg.
Bachelor of Arts, Univercity Nebraska, 1925; Bachelor of Science in Medicine, U. Nebraska, 1926; Doctor of Medicine, University Nebraska, 1928.
Intern University Nebraska Hospital, 1928-1930. Postgraduate Manhattan Eye and Ear Hospital, New York City, 1930-1932. Resident Babies Hospital-Columbia University Medical Center, 1933.
Ship surgeon American Export and Grace Steamship Lines, 1934. Practice medicine, specializing in eye, ear, nose and throat York, Nebraska, from 1934. Staff York General Hospital.
Consultant in ophthalmology student health University Nebraska.
Chairman Coordinating Council for Public Higher Education in Nebraska. Member national advisory council Center Disease Control, Atlanta. Board directors Nebraska division American Cancer Society.
Trustee Nebraska Medical Foundation. Regent University Nebraska, since 1953, president board, 1957, 63, 68, vice president, 1967-1970. Member advisory council Nebraska Center for Regional Progress.
Alternate delegate National Republican Convention, 1972. Fellow American Medical Association. Member Australian Computer Society, Nebraska Medical Association (councilor 1955-1961), National Association Governing Boards State Universities and Allied Institutes (president 1961-1962, president foundation from 1961 ), York County Medical Society (past president) Clubs: Mason, Rotarian (Cadwallader award 1969).
